Technical Specifications (50 % of Article)

Parameter Standard Model Custom Range Unit
Material Liquid Silicone Rubber (LSR) – Medical Grade LSR, HTV, RTV (based on spec)
Operating Temperature -50 °C ~ 200 °C -70 °C ~ 250 °C (with high‑temp additives) °C
Maximum Working Pressure 10 bar 5 ~ 25 bar bar
Back‑flow Leakage ≤0.02 % ≤0.01 % (tight‑tolerance custom) %
Flow Direction Uni‑directional (flapper) Uni‑/bi‑directional (dual‑flap)
Connection Type ¼‑inch NPT, ½‑inch BSPT Metric M12‑M24, Custom CNC‑machined ports
Certifications CE, ISO 9001, FDA 21 CFR 820 CE, FDA, UL, RoHS, GS, VDE, SAA
Typical Cycle Time 15 s (injection) + 10 s (cure) 12 s ~ 18 s (depending on part size) seconds
Dimensions (Ø × L) 20 mm × 35 mm 10 mm ~ 100 mm (custom) mm
